Transaction 372a1e31ed88a1e56e3b13754959b4181fcaa69d0f2e670556441a69a50de00e
1 Input
1 Output
-
372a1e31ed88a1e56e3b13754959b4181fcaa69d0f2e670556441a69a50de00e:0
- value
- 669253
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2523c29e7086cb9e112937788fbcf7f446bae8a7 OP_EQUAL
- address
- 355PmJh3swf4LWjKooEb8i8xdrjXvSoKXz